40 • THE ARTISAN SPRING 2025 e journey down the Witches Road in Agatha All Along was so much more than a superhero story—it really was magical. e layers that are woven into each character's personal stories and the use of practical sets and effects for telling these stories was such an incredible experience to help bring to life. I was brought on as Department Head Make- up by Kathryn Hahn since I designed and applied her "Agatha Harkness" make-up on Wandavision. I hired Erin LeBre as my key make-up artist because we've worked together before and make a great creative team. We began filming in Los Angeles and were one of the last shows to use the iconic Warner Bros. Ranch. Aer that, we added Tana Medina as our third make-up artist when we moved to Atlanta, Georgia. e script delved not only into Agatha's history but all six of our characters' backstories which gave us the opportunity to design make-up looks from the 1700s to present day. It was a great challenge that included A LOT of research, since we wanted to use period-correct colors, technique, nails, and lashes.
